Industrial water as a share of total water withdrawals in Poland
Poland: Industrial water as a share of total water withdrawals was 65.5% in 2022. ▼ Falling
Industrial water as a share of total water withdrawals in Poland, 1992–2022
Source: AQUASTAT - FAO's Global Information System on Water and Agriculture, FAO, via World Bank (2026) – processed by Our World in Data. Measured in % of total freshwater withdrawal.
Analysis
Poland recorded 65.5% for industrial water as a share of total water withdrawals in 2022.
The figure is up 1.1% on the previous year and down 1.7% over ten years.
Over the whole period, industrial water as a share of total water withdrawals in Poland peaked at 74.5% in 2002 and was at its lowest, 64.0%, in 2020.
That places Poland 15th out of 179 countries with data for 2022, putting it in the top 10%.
The long-run direction has been consistently falling across the 31 years of available data.
Industrial water as a share of total water withdrawals in Poland, year by year
| Year | % of total freshwater withdrawal | Change |
|---|---|---|
| 1992 | 68.6% | — |
| 1993 | 69.6% | +1.5% |
| 1994 | 70.6% | +1.5% |
| 1995 | 71.7% | +1.5% |
| 1996 | 72.6% | +1.4% |
| 1997 | 73.6% | +1.4% |
| 1998 | 73.5% | -0.2% |
| 1999 | 73.3% | -0.2% |
| 2000 | 73.2% | -0.2% |
| 2001 | 73.2% | -0.0% |
| 2002 | 74.5% | +1.9% |
| 2003 | 72.9% | -2.2% |
| 2004 | 72.3% | -0.8% |
| 2005 | 71.9% | -0.6% |
| 2006 | 71.7% | -0.2% |
| 2007 | 67.0% | -6.6% |
| 2008 | 70.9% | +5.8% |
| 2009 | 67.6% | -4.6% |
| 2010 | 70.4% | +4.2% |
| 2011 | 70.9% | +0.7% |
| 2012 | 66.6% | -6.0% |
| 2013 | 71.4% | +7.1% |
| 2014 | 71.5% | +0.2% |
| 2015 | 71.1% | -0.7% |
| 2016 | 70.7% | -0.5% |
| 2017 | 69.8% | -1.3% |
| 2018 | 64.9% | -7.0% |
| 2019 | 64.5% | -0.7% |
| 2020 | 64.0% | -0.7% |
| 2021 | 64.8% | +1.1% |
| 2022 | 65.5% | +1.1% |
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1990s | 71.7% | 68.6% | 73.6% | 8 |
| 2000s | 71.5% | 67.0% | 74.5% | 10 |
| 2010s | 69.2% | 64.5% | 71.5% | 10 |
| 2020s | 64.8% | 64.0% | 65.5% | 3 |

About this data
Industrial water withdrawals as a percentage of total water withdrawals (which is the sum of water used for agriculture, industry, and municipal purposes).
